    Default RE: foam

    hey, if you guys try this, let me know how it works out. the black pond foam i got from dr's foster and smith worked great, never had any problems w/ it UNDER WATER.

    above water it deteriorated when exposed to sunlight, I can only imagine what my halides wouldhave done to it.
